River quiche recipe details
- Ingredients
- May use pie crust with salsa lightly covering the bottom or butter 10-inch pie plate quiche dish
- 12 slices of crisp bacon (or substitute ham or shrimp)
- 1 cup Swiss cheese
- 1/3 cup diced onion or chives
- 1/2 cup Bisquickbaking mix
- 4 eggs
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/8 teaspoon pepper
- 2 cups milk
Crumble bacon, sprinkle cheese and chives or onions in dish. Blend remaining ingredients in blender on high speed for 1 minute. Pour into dish or pie crust over bacon, cheese, chives or onions. Bake 50 minutes at 350 degrees. Let stand five minutes.
